Where Copilot lives

Two surfaces: Copilot Chat (the cross-app assistant grounded in your work data and the web, in Teams/Outlook/the web) and in-app Copilot embedded in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Outlook, and Teams. Chat reasons across everything you can access; in-app helps with the document or task in front of you. There is a free Copilot Chat tier and the paid Microsoft 365 Copilot add-on that unlocks deep work-data grounding and the in-app experiences.

Prompting: Goal, Context, Source, Expectations

Microsoft's framework is Goal + Context + Source + Expectations (add persona/tone if useful). The biggest quality move is naming the Source explicitly with the / picker so the answer is grounded and citable. Specify an output contract (audience + format + length). Iterate with follow-ups rather than expecting a perfect one-shot, and use Copilot Lab for vetted starter prompts.

In the apps

Word — draft from a source, rewrite/adjust tone, summarize, and ask the document questions. Excel — insights, formula columns, conditional formatting, charts; requires structured tables. PowerPoint — build decks from a Word doc, redesign, summarize. Outlook — thread summaries, drafted replies, coaching. Teams — intelligent recap, action items with owners, real-time catch-up. The recurring pattern: ground in a real source, give a clear audience/format, review the draft.

Agents, security & rollout

Agents are scoped Copilots grounded on specific knowledge and instructions, built as declarative agents or in Copilot Studio (low-code) and shared via the agent store. Governance: permissions are honored but oversharing is inherited, so remediate loose SharePoint/OneDrive access first; sensitivity labels are respected and admins have a management dashboard. Rollout is the real bottleneck — train on prompting, seed a shared prompt library, name champions, measure outcomes.
